
Summary: In this paper, the concept of \(k\)-regular fuzzy matrix as a generalization of regular matrix is introduced and some basic properties of a \(k\)-regular fuzzy matrix are derived. This leads to the characterization of a matrix for which the regularity index and the index are identical. Further the relation between regular, \(k\)-regular and regularity of powers of fuzzy matrices are discussed.
